Experience the coastal landscape and discover hidden gems by boat in Sunnhordland. From Bømlo, you can bring family and friends on a fjord cruise with MS Venemøy, passing charming coastal communities and weaving between islands and skerries towards the open sea.
Åkrafjorden Oppleving offers fjord cruises during the June–September season to Langfoss in Etne, named by CNN Travel as one of the world’s most beautiful waterfalls. They also provide customised group tours with the boat MS Stein Viking from April to October.
Kystoppleving with MS Venemøy offers tailor-made tours for groups all year round, as well as scheduled trips throughout July.
